  • Esquina Homero Manzi - Experience the genuine and classic Tango Show in the Boedo Neighborhood!

Situated at the intersection of San Juan and Boedo, this iconic and historic venue is a cornerstone of Buenos Aires culture. Established in 1927, it became a beacon of the city’s urban culture during the 1940s, drawing in the musicians who turned Tango into the city’s most celebrated and artistic musical form. The show boasts a five-piece orchestra, three pairs of dancers, and two vocalists.

The culinary offerings reflect the country’s traditional cuisine.

The ‘Menu Sur’ is available for those opting for dinner, which includes starters, a main course, and desserts.

Beverages are complimentary with the dinner package.

Enjoyable night out - great steak dinner - The Homero Manzi Tango Show was in an interesting venue with lots of character. The show, like all of them, starts late. Seating is at individual tables, but they are close together so you can chat with others before the show. We would definitely recommend you book the whole package including the dinner. The steak was one of the best we have had and certainly reflects the quality of Argentinian beef. Drinks were good...we had the beer but people we chatted with at other tables said the red wine was good with the meal. The show itself is a combination of song, dance and music. It's the only Tango show we have been to, so can't compare it with others, but it certainly gave us a sense of what Tango is all about in South America. Waiters are pleasant and helpful, and they will expect a tip so make sure you have pesos to take care of that. We were told between 500-1,000 depending on the service you receive. There are so many shows available it's hard to choose, but we chose this one because friends had recommended it. We enjoyed it.
